Keying Scheme ~ Modules and Power Shelves
Eltek rectifier and converter modules are available in a vast range of output voltages,
and all the rectifiers may be physically inserted in the same rectifier power shelf and all
converters in the same converter power shelf.
A keying scheme is designed to achieve that a specific module is only plugged into a
suitable power shelf, thus avoiding damaging the module and the power system.
The keying scheme is based in inserting one or several keys (or small pieces of
plastic) in the slots (position 1-6) located both on the module's chassis and on the power
shelf's chassis.

When a module and a power shelf have a key inserted in the same position, the module
will not plug into the shelf.
A slot with inserted key may be indicated with "1", and an empty slot with "0".
For example, a power shelf suitable for 24V Flatpack2 solar chargers will be shipped from
factory keyed as <110 001>. Then, only modules keyed as <001 110> can be plugged
into the shelf, e.g. the Flatpack2 24/1500 HE Solar Chargers.
In general, modules and power shelves for industrial applications are always keyed at
factory. When required, Eltek will also ship keyed modules and power shelves for telecom
applications.
NOTICE:
A keyed power shelf will ONLY allow modules keyed for the specific shelf to be plugged in the shelf.
A non-keyed power shelf will allow both keyed and non-keyed modules to be plugged in the shelf.
CAUTION:
!
Never install Flatpack2 modules in power shelves with different output voltage than the module's. The module's
output voltage and the power system's output voltage must always be the same.
